I'm having trouble finding someone who supplies windshields for a 67.5 1600 low wind shield.

I found one at Rallye Ent. but they want like over $700 bucks for it, plus shipping from CA I think. Yet the windshield for a 68 model is only 300 bucks.

Are the windshields for a '67 really that hard to find.

I could almost find a junked 1600 for 700 bucks.

Can anybody give me some other options, if there are any.

RE:Low Windshield Glass

Post by S Allen »

Unfortunately you are experiencing one of the shocks of roadster ownership. Up until several years ago the windshields were still a dealership item for around $200.00 and some change. They are pretty much NLA now. You might give Dean of Fairlady Products a call. He had some but they were pricy too! Check with your local automotive glass place. A buddy got one for his low windshield at a considerable savings. It never hurts to check. There are some after market ones that come out of south america but it is not an easy item to find.
